Packers Everywhere set to host free pep rally in San Francisco

Fans can sign up for Packers Pass for a chance to win autographed Packers prizes

Packers fans are invited to bring the spirit of Green Bay to the San Francisco area a day early with a Packers Everywhere pep rally at 6 p.m. PST on Saturday, Jan. 18.

The festivities will take place at The Patio, located at 412 Emerson St., Palo Alto, Calif. The Patio will open at 11 a.m., with pre-rally festivities and Packers prizing beginning at 4 p.m.

Packers President/CEO Mark Murphy will take part in the pre-gameday excitement by greeting fans and participating in a Q-and-A session with the radio voice of the Packers, Wayne Larrivee. Packers alumni Jordy Nelson, Lynn Dickey and James Lofton will attend to socialize and take photos with fans and will share their thoughts on the next day's game against the 49ers.

A roundtable discussion with Packers.com's Mike Spofford and Wes Hodkiewicz will conclude the event.

Fans planning to attend the rally are encouraged to sign up in advance for Packers Pass to have a chance to win autographed Packers items such as a Kenny Clark signed-helmet, Mason Crosby signed-jersey, and other prizes.

To register for the opportunity to win prizes, fans should download the official Packers mobile app or visit packers.com/pass to sign up. Rally attendees must have their Packers Pass scanned on-site at the designated prizing area in order to see if they've won. Entrants must be present at the rally to win, and advance Packers Pass signup does not guarantee rally admission.

Packers Everywhere, through its website packerseverywhere.com, enables Packers fans to find official Packers establishments around the world where they can watch games with fellow fans.
